    Authorities in northwest Indiana waiting for test results in death investigation

    (WBBM NEWSRADIO) — A death investigation continues at a home in Wheatfield, Indiana.

    Authorities in Jasper County say it involves a tip received last month that an individual had allegedly confessed to acquaintances about killing two of their undocumented children and burning their bodies in a backyard fire pit.

    Detectives located suspects at a hotel in Newton County and conducted interviews. Although the suspects denied any involvement, their cell phones were seized as evidence.

    The child who was in their care was taken into protective custody by the Indiana Department of Child Services.

    A cadaver dog search of the property on the 4200 block of Old Orchard Lane uncovered bone fragments.

    On Tuesday, bone fragments were submitted to a specialist, in Indianapolis, for analysis to determine if they were from an infant or an animal.
